Aisha Achimugu, OFR, an Abuja-based businesswoman and Chief Executive Officer of Felak Concept Group, a firm specializing in civil, structural, and transportation engineering, is one of the highly respected employers of labor in the country.
Undoubtedly, the serial entrepreneur, who deals in the exploration, production, and distribution of petroleum products, has made and continues to make significant contributions to the nation’s economy.
She has proved to be someone who matches street smartness with book wisdom.
Brick by brick, Achimugu has built a vast layout of opportunities for young Nigerians and has demonstrated that greatness can be earned through diligence and hard work, making a great impact in various sectors.
At different times, the Founder and President of SAM Empowerment Foundation has also been duly recognized for her industry and philanthropy within and outside the country.
Interestingly, last night, Saturday, March 1, at the prestigious Eko Hotel and Suites, Victoria Island, Lagos, family, friends, and fans shared in the joy of the 51-year-old, who holds a degree in Accounting from the University of Jos and a Master’s in Business Management from the University of Belize, when she bagged the Entrepreneur of the Year Award at The Sun Newspapers Awards ceremony.
During the ceremony, many of the distinguished guests were said to have remarked that she would have also won an award for Philanthropist of the Year if such a category existed.
Indeed, she is not lagging behind in philanthropy, considering that her well-documented humanitarian gestures have impacted millions of people and communities in Nigeria over the years.
